Requirements
  • A Master’s or PhD in Electrical Engineering or a related discipline from an accredited institution, or equivalent knowledge or experience.
  • At least 10 years of overall experience in protection and control system design and studies, including at least 5 years developing detailed design specifications for protection and control algorithms, preferably in a relay manufacturing environment.
  • Extensive experience in power system protection, automation, and control product design.
  • Working knowledge of MATLAB and Simulink for model design and power system simulation tools such as RTDS, PSCAD, or ATP/EMTP.
  • A proven record of publishing and presenting at industry forums and conferences.
  • Familiarity with industry standards and documentation procedures used by electrical utilities.
  • Knowledge of modern protection, control, and distribution automation developments and trends.
  • Knowledge or experience of metering and wireless, Ethernet, or serial communications applicable to protection and control, including IEC 61850, Modbus, DNP3.0, and IEC 60870-5-103.

GE Vernova is a global energy company created in 2024 to support the electricity grid and the energy transition, with three focuses: Power, Wind, and Electrification. It sells large-scale equipment, signs long-term service agreements, and provides software to utilities, independent power producers, grid operators, and large industrial energy users. Its products include H-Class gas turbines that can burn natural gas with blends of hydrogen toward 100% hydrogen, Haliade-X offshore wind turbines up to 14.7 MW, and GridOS software that unifies grid data to help manage networks and integrate renewables. By combining hardware, services, and software under GE heritage, it aims to meet rising electricity demand while accelerating decarbonization across global energy systems.

GE Vernova holds $176B backlog yet stock dips 5% as wind losses and spending increases spook investors

GE Vernova, General Electric's former energy division spun off in 2024, reported a $176.3 billion backlog in Q2 2026, up 37% year-over-year. The company's growth has been driven by expanding cloud, AI, and data centre markets requiring increased power infrastructure. Total orders surged 89% in the first half of 2026, with Power and Electrification segments rising 99% and 131% respectively. GE Vernova expects full-year revenue growth of 19% to 22%. Despite strong performance, shares declined 5% over the past month whilst the S&P 500 gained 3%. The pullback followed Q2 results where adjusted EBITDA and earnings per share missed Wall Street expectations due to increased capacity spending and additional losses in the Wind division.

GE Vernova books $176B backlog with 134% gas order growth as Eaton rides 65% data center surge

GE Vernova and Eaton released second-quarter 2026 results highlighting surging demand from AI infrastructure buildout. Vernova reported $5.50 billion in Power segment revenue with gas equipment orders up 134% organically. The company booked $2.7 billion in data centre orders during the quarter alone and expects to reach at least 125 gigawatts of gas equipment under contract by year-end. Total backlog stands at $176 billion. Eaton posted revenue of $8.531 billion, up 21.39%, with adjusted earnings per share of $3.15. Data centre revenue grew roughly 65% in both its Electrical Americas and Electrical Global divisions. The Boyd Thermal liquid-cooling business, acquired for $9.55 billion in March, generated $432 million in second-quarter revenue. Vernova guided free cash flow to $11.5 billion to $12.5 billion, whilst Eaton raised its full-year earnings guidance to $13.40 to $13.60 per share.

GE Vernova raises 2026 guidance as revenue hits $11.1B, orders surge 88%

GE Vernova reported mixed second-quarter 2026 results, missing earnings expectations but beating revenue estimates. The company posted revenues of $11.1 billion, up 22% year over year, driven by equipment growth in its Power and Electrification segments. Orders surged 88% organically to $24.2 billion, whilst backlog grew by $13 billion sequentially. The Power segment saw orders jump 134% organically, with revenues increasing 14% to $5.5 billion. Electrification revenues rose 66% organically to $6.3 billion. GE Vernova raised its 2026 guidance, now expecting revenues of $45.5-$46.5 billion and free cash flow of $11.5-$12.5 billion, up from previous forecasts. Data centre orders have exceeded $5 billion year to date, more than doubling 2025 figures, as the company benefits from growing electricity demand and grid modernisation efforts.
